J-Hope on solo struggles and illness on tour; shares excitement for long-awaited BTS reunion
BTS member J-Hope will give fans a glimpse into the life of the global superstar beyond the stage lights in an upcoming installment of MBC reality show, The Manager (Omniscient Interfering View). On June 14 at 11:10 p.m. KST, the episode delivers both the electric highs and softer, more vulnerable lows of J-Hope's solo career—just as the world is counting down to a eagerly awaited BTS reunion.
Life on the road: Passion, pressure, and performance
A preview clip that came out on June 7 already launched anticipation into overdrive. The episode will be presenting J-Hope's tireless commitment throughout his HOPE ON THE STAGE solo tour. He can be seen carefully rehearsing dance routines, refining every show, and sticking to a disciplined regimen consisting of disciplined exercise, healthy eating, and periods of quiet contemplation.
The comparison between his solo tour and group tours of BTS is telling. Where there was formerly the energy and fellowship of seven, now stands a sense of solitude and individual responsibility. "When it was [all of] BTS, we always had catering," J-Hope fondly recalls. "When it was the seven of us performing, we would always get together and sit around as one.". Now, I’m on my own.” The episode will highlight how J-Hope has adapted to this new dynamic, shouldering the pressures of a solo career while still cherishing the bond he shares with his groupmates.
Battling sickness on tour
One of the most insightful details is provided by J-Hope's manager, who reveals the physical price the artist paid for the tour. Throughout the demanding schedule, J-Hope became sick with a fever of 39.5°C (more than 103°F). The manager remembers J-Hope begging the medical team to "save him," a detail that has raised alarm and admiration from fans for his unbreakable dedication to the performance.

Counting down to the BTS reunion
Arguably the most sentimental moment of the preview is J-Hope's response to the approaching discharge of his BTS colleagues from military service. With RM, V, SUGA, Jimin, and Jungkook all due to finish their service by the end of June, the promise of a BTS reunion is finally near. "There's really less than a month left until the members are discharged," J-Hope states, visibly touched. "I can't believe BTS' release is already here." The mere possibility of the group coming back together again after all these years gives him hope and excitement, something shared by millions of ARMYs worldwide.
When and where to watch
Fans looking forward to seeing this unguarded side of J-Hope can watch The Manager on June 14 at 11:10 p.m. KST on MBC. The show guarantees a special glimpse into the life of an artist who has evolved both as a performer and as an individual over the course of his solo career.
